An 18-year-old man is fighting for his life after being stabbed in Canary Wharf. 

Met Police responded to reports from the London Ambulance Service of a stabbing in Upper Bank Street at 7.42pm yesterday (October 19). 

The victim is reported to be in a critical condition. 

A Met Police spokesperson said: "Police were called by LAS at 19:41hrs on Thursday, 19 October to reports of a stabbing in Upper Bank Street E14.

"Officers responded but those involved had left the scene prior to police arrival.

"An 18-year-old man was traced to an east London hospital with stab injuries to his face and arm; he remains there in a life-threatening condition.

"At this early stage there have been no arrests. Enquiries are ongoing and a scene is in place."
